#f93118 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#f93118 is composed of 97.6% red, 19.2% green and 9.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 80.3% magenta, 90.4% yellow and 2.4% black. It has a hue angle of 6.7 degrees, a saturation of 94.9% and a lightness of 53.5%. #f93118 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ff6230 with #f30000. Closest websafe color is: #ff3300.

#f93118 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#f93118 has RGB values of R:249, G:49, B:24 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.8, Y:0.9, K:0.02. Its decimal value is 16331032.

Shades and Tints of #f93118

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#120200 is the darkest color, while #fffefd is the lightest one.

Tones of #f93118

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#8c8685 is the less saturated color, while #f93118 is the most saturated one.
